AS7C1025C-15JIN Description
AS7C1025C-15JIN Description
The AS7C1025C-15JIN is a 1Mbit Static Random Access Memory (SRAM) IC designed by Alliance Memory, Inc. This memory chip features a parallel memory interface and is organized as 128K x 8, providing a total memory capacity of 1Mbit. It operates with a supply voltage range of 4.5V to 5.5V and offers an access time of 15 ns, ensuring fast data retrieval. The write cycle time for both word and page operations is also 15 ns, making it highly efficient for applications requiring rapid data processing.
The AS7C1025C-15JIN is packaged in a tube and is designed for surface mount applications, making it suitable for modern printed circuit board (PCB) designs. It is classified under the HTSUS code 8542.32.0041 and has a moisture sensitivity level (MSL) of 3, which allows for 168 hours of exposure before assembly. This SRAM IC is compliant with REACH and ROHS3 standards, ensuring environmental safety and regulatory compliance.
AS7C1025C-15JIN Features
- Memory Type: Volatile SRAM, ensuring data is retained as long as power is supplied.
- Memory Organization: 128K x 8, providing a total memory capacity of 1Mbit.
- Access Time: 15 ns, ensuring fast data retrieval and processing.
- Write Cycle Time: 15 ns for both word and page operations, maintaining high performance.
- Supply Voltage: Operates within a range of 4.5V to 5.5V, suitable for a variety of power supply configurations.
- Mounting Type: Surface mount, ideal for modern PCB designs.
- Package: Tube, ensuring safe and secure storage and handling.
- Moisture Sensitivity Level (MSL): Level 3 (168 hours), providing flexibility in assembly processes.
- Compliance: REACH unaffected and ROHS3 compliant, ensuring environmental safety and regulatory adherence.
